The fourth argument can be set to 0. It is important to crank up the rpict ambient calulcation or you will miss the glow source, because it can only be caught by -ad and -as rays
 
rpict -ab 1 -ad 8000 ...

	I have some problems with glow and spotlight material.
	
	I made a simple scene with only two surfaces facing each other.
	One of surfaces is light source and the other is plastic.
	the plastic surface (1x1m) is 5m apart from the light source material(1x1m)
	
	And I plugged in different light source material to see if there is differernt.
	
	Light and illum material result in the same illuminance value as that by hand
	calcuation.
	
	When it comes to glow material, it seems to me odd.
	The first, It is said that the fourth argument, maxrad in the glow material can
	be negative, zero, and positive.
	
	When the fourth argument is zero, illuminance value on the floor(1x1m) which is
	5m apart from the glow material(1x1) is not uniform.
	
	Light amd illum material result in the uniform illuminance value on the floor
	with the same geometry material setting.
	
	It seems to me that rendering parameter might not correct because the center of
	the floor is darker than the edge of the floor or it comes from Desktop
	Radiance or it is because I did not understand the fourth argument in the glow
	material.
